Overview

Marquee brands, such as Apple, Nike, and Coca-Cola, have become an integral part of consumer culture, with a significant impact on the global economy and society. These brands have managed to create a strong emotional connection with their customers, transcending their products and services to become cultural phenomena. With a combined value of over $1 trillion, these brands have been able to adapt to changing consumer preferences and technological advancements, while maintaining their core values and identity. However, they also face challenges such as maintaining their relevance, managing their environmental and social impact, and navigating the complexities of global markets. As the consumer landscape continues to evolve, marquee brands must innovate and transform to remain relevant, with some, like Tesla, already making significant strides in this direction. The future of marquee brands will be shaped by their ability to balance tradition with innovation, and to create meaningful connections with their customers, with the likes of Amazon and Google already setting the pace.
